Nsanshi Art Studio was established in 2019 as part of Kansanshi Mining
Kansanshi Mining, a subsidiary of First Quantum Minerals (FQM), is leading a transformative effort to empower local artisans, particularly women, through Nsanshi Art Studio.
This Corporate Social Investment initiative, in collaboration with the Jewellery and Gemstone Association of Africa (JGAA), is providing skills training, fostering entrepreneurship, and helping Zambian artisans gain global recognition.

This year marks a significant step forward in Nsanshi Art’s journey, with an increased focus on global training and market access. In February, the studio welcomed Longo Mulaisho-Zinsner, founder and president of strategy at JGAA, and Kelvin Birk, a German-trained UK-based jeweller and founder of K2 Academy. Their visit aimed to refine students’ techniques and prepare them for Nsanshi Art’s first-ever showcase at GemGenève, one of the world’s most prestigious jewellery exhibitions.

Nsanshi Art is more than just a community development initiative, it represents a long-term investment in Zambia’s creative economy. By adding value to locally sourced minerals, promoting ethical jewellery production, and nurturing home-grown talent, Kansanshi Mining is positioning Zambia as a rising force in the global jewellery market.

About First Quantum Minerals Ltd
First Quantum Minerals Ltd is a global metals and mining company producing mainly copper, gold and nickel. The company’s assets are in Zambia, Spain, Mauritania, Australia, Finland, Turkey, Panama, Argentina and Peru.
In 2024, First Quantum globally produced 431,000 tonnes of copper, 139,000 ounces of gold and 24,000 tonnes of nickel.
In Zambia it operates the Kansanshi mine and smelter in Solwezi, and the Sentinel copper mine and the Enterprise nickel mine in Kalumbila.
The company is listed on the Toronto Stock Exchange.
